Bota in context

With 1,372 people at the 2011 Census, Bota was the 151st most populous of its district's 1748 villages, above the district average of 583.

Literacy stood at 51.44%, 11.4 points below the district's rural average of 62.86%.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 1112, 189 above the rural national 923.
